Output 8f14ffeae68526072e1b19b7786c6c6f0322c98ddf0c352e5da2e97717a9be3f:0

value
28508700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b710f45ff7f83e8a2b4cc50313be6ce5a5ec22c2 OP_EQUAL
address
3JNytg4QLTnbLYh9LuA9H95jFoqqhVJkdS
transaction
8f14ffeae68526072e1b19b7786c6c6f0322c98ddf0c352e5da2e97717a9be3f
spent
true